The poorest man in the world is the man limited to his own experiencesjhe man without books." It is a known fact that books are indispensable for all human beings. This article discusses the need of separate literature for children, which is different from that of adults for several reasons. To clarify this point, we first explain reading through which literature is presented. Goodman and Niles (1970:5) explain reading as "a complex process by which a reader reconstructs, to some degree, a message encoded by a writer in graphic language."
